|  9 Groups - 10 Berths. 4 groups with 4 teams and 5 groups with 3 teams. |  | Only Albania from all UEFA members did not take part. Eliminated: Reigning European Champion from EC 1976 - Czechoslovakia. |  | Goal difference tie-break was introduced. Italy was ahead of England by this criteria. |  | From 1974 Austria, France, Spain and Hungary replaced East Germany, Bulgaria, Yugoslavia and Chile (from Play-off). |  |   |
